Ep. 2: You Were Never Really Here

The second episode of our film podcast is now live! This in-depth conversation about Lynne Ramsay’s You Were Never Really Here is a great complement to our ebook You Were Never Really Here: A Special Issue.

Last week, we launched our brand new film podcast with an episode about Debra Granik’s Leave No Trace. This was only the first of many in-depth recorded conversations to come, about some of the best films in recent years — we are now posting our second podcast episode, this one about Lynne Ramsay’s You Were Never Really Here, one of the best films of 2018.

For this second episode, our host and Associate Editor Elena Lazic and Associate Editor Orla Smith, who spearheaded our Special Issue on You Were Never Really Here, are joined by Editor-in-Chief Alex Heeney for a discussion on Lynne Ramsay’s fourth film. Between them, Orla and Elena have interviewed the key creative team behind the film, and they share the insights they gained from each of the interviews and from the collective group of them. The panel also addresses the film’s approach to the hitman genre, Ramsay’s visceral and haptic filmmaking, and more.

To get the most out of this podcast episode, we recommend listeners watch You Were Never Really Here and/or read our Special Issue on it before listening.

This podcast episode on You Were Never Really Here was edited by Edward von Aderkas.
